Modernizing Fleet Management: Key Trends in Ambulance Vehicle Technology, Design, and Connectivity for Optimized Response

0
0

 

The operational efficiency and effectiveness of the Emergency Medical Services (EMS) market are intrinsically linked to the continuous modernization of its vehicle fleet, encompassing ground ambulances, air ambulances (helicopters and fixed-wing aircraft), and specialized rapid-response units. Key Emergency Medical Services Market trends in this segment are focused on three main areas: enhanced safety, improved clinical utility, and connectivity. New ambulance designs prioritize crew safety, incorporating crash-test-certified patient compartments, improved restraint systems, and ergonomic layouts to reduce the risk of injury to personnel providing care while the vehicle is in motion. Clinically, vehicles are being designed to maximize the workspace for advanced procedures and to house increasingly sophisticated, modular equipment, including secure docking stations for portable ventilators and monitoring devices. This focus on internal design allows the ambulance to truly function as a mobile medical facility.

Connectivity is the revolutionary factor, with modern ambulances equipped with GPS for real-time tracking, advanced mapping software for optimized routing to the nearest appropriate facility, and robust mobile communication platforms (often 4G/5G enabled) for seamless data transmission. The move towards electronic fleet management systems provides dispatch centers with real-time operational data on vehicle availability, maintenance needs, and crew status, significantly reducing downtime and improving the overall efficiency of the service. Furthermore, environmental concerns are driving the development and testing of hybrid and fully electric ambulances, which promise lower operational costs and reduced carbon footprints. While air ambulance services continue to be critical for remote areas and major trauma cases, ground ambulance manufacturers are adopting automotive safety standards and integrating advanced vehicle telematics to ensure that the transport element of the EMS chain is as safe, swift, and technologically advanced as the care delivered inside.
